This course is designed to teach you how to use zos job control language jcl and selected zos utility programs in an online batch environment. This paper is a miniuser guide for dfsorts versatile icetool data processing and reporting utility. If you were doing a sort, and the input dataset is of sufficient size, then the sortwknn files are used to hold the partially sorted data as things are going along, and to write the fullysorted data from. Updated to unified design date 81597 10206 by jcl jcl unless otherwise specified, dimensions are in inches. Let us start with an example jcl, how it looks like, the following jcl is used to run an cobol program. Merge two or more pdf, web pages, jpeg and png files into one compact pdf thats easy to share, archive. Here we are going to discuss about the file aid for files. Following are the steps to merge multiple pdf documents. Examples that use disk or tape in place of actual device names or numbers must be changed before use. Jul 01, 2015 this tutorial will show you how to merge two files or two sets of records using ibm dfsort. The database services component also maintains certain control and descriptor.
A few of them are listed below with their functionality. This course looks at the iebgener, icegener, iebcompr, iehlist and dfsort utilities and provides reallife examples describing how they are used to interrogate and modify data set content. Ltr description date by jcl updated to unified design jcl. Merge and split pdf files in batch using apex pdf merger software. You do not need dynamic allocation of work data sets or sortwkdd dd statements. The easy readability of the jcl job flow allows you to search, view, analyze, print and map your jcls in a fraction of the time it would take on the mainframe. I want to copy a flat file to multiple files using some jcl utility. Merge pdf files combine pdfs in the order you want with the easiest pdf merger available. Originally, it just sorted two ini files so that they could easily be compared using windiff.
Pdf merger allows you to merge pdf files fast and easy, everything is online, free and with no registration, try it now. Ez400nmhpld type n male plug nonsolder pin for lmr400 cable. Job queuing jes decides the priority of the job based on class and prty parameters in the job statement. You can use data set utility programs to reorganize, change, or compare data at the data set or record level. The jcl requirements for these utilities, along with their control statement syntax, is also covered in detail. The file has field separators that look like this, fileaid utility in jcl pdf fileaid tutorial reference study material help.
Our servers in the cloud will handle the pdf creation for you once you have combined your files. Unsubscribe from tutorials point india ltd cancel unsubscribe. The merge control statement must be used when a merge operation is to be performed. Pdf merge combine pdf files free tool to merge pdf. This suite of programs will describe and demonstrate how to merge multiple files of various record lengths into a single file. The following requirements can be met using below mentioned jcl utilities. Pdf merge combine pdf files free tool to merge pdf online. Table 1 is a list of data set utility programs and their use. When using the allocate command, the following considerations apply. You can also convert pdf files into word or rtf format, merge multiple pdf files together into one manageable document, and split your.
If you want to learn the basic workings of dfsort before going through the merge process, go through below post. A free and open source software to merge, split, rotate and extract pages from pdf files. This information is divided into two groups, which is namely catalog and the directory. It consisted a single instruction a branch to register 14. Dynamically binding or linkediting user exit routines468 assembler user exit routines input phase user exits469. The data set utilities included in this publication cannot be used with vsam data sets. The major features of icetool for zos dfsort v1r10 used for zos 1. I have seen in banking and telecom domain, the usage with outfil is much. Fixed, variable, or undefined records from blocked or unblocked data sets or members can also be compared. Jcl sort or syncsort utility in jcl is used to sort the datasets, merge datasets and copy datasets. File aid tutorial and useful commands file aid user. Free online pdf tools merge any file format into single pdf.
Instantly expand jcl with software intelligence incom. Generate the jcl required to submit a file aid batch job or any other non file aid batch utility with file aid s. Pdffilemerger stricttrue initializes a pdffilemerger object. Fileaid is a very useful tool in the mainframes, it can be used to browse ps, vsam, edit the files basically. Information about vsam data sets can be found in zos dfsms using data sets. I need to replace a string of characters with another in a dataset. Mainframe express has a number of utility programs which emulate the functions of many commonlyused mainframe batch utilities. C processes all standard os390 and zos access methods and file formats. Pdfbox merging multiple pdf documents tutorialspoint. See the functions merge or append and write for usage information. These drawings and specifications contain proprietary information which is the property of times microwave systems. Soda pdf is the solution for users looking to merge multiple files into a single pdf document. Sort merge users guide vi 47 a2 08uf syntax notation the following conventions are used for presenting jcl command syntax.
On the format tab, select sysin data jcl as the file type if you are sending a raw data file, under jcl files select the beginning and ending jcl files, the send mode, and length if necessary. If the first set of data is not sorted, your job shall abend with s000 u0016. Without a jcl, you cant able to run a job on mvs operating system. Pdf merge tool allows you to easily and quickly merge multiple files with different formats in a single pdf file. Write to multiple output datasetscovert fb file to vb fileconverts vb. C extends the power of the current ispf pdf environment with new and additional features. User labels will not be copied to the output data sets. Chapter 2 describes the files and resources needed by sortmerge. Job control language i about the tutorial job control language jcl is the command language of multiple virtual storage mvs, which is the commonly used operating system in the ibm mainframe computers. Pdffilemerger merges multiple pdfs into a single pdf. Journal of child language instructions for contributors a key publication in the field, journal of child language publishes articles on all aspects of the scientific study of language behaviour in children, the principles which underlie it, and the theories which may account for it. Iebcompr is a data set utility that is used to compare two sequential data sets, two partitioned data sets or two partisioned data sets pdses at the logical record level to verify a backup copy. The option stopaft will stop reading the input file after 10th record and terminates the program.
The catalog consists of regular tables and is accessible by means of sql. Machine lab exercises complement the lecture material. Below is the general structure of file aid batch processing jcl. It can concatenate, slice, insert, or any combination of the above. Fileaids powerful editor, it is used to browse, edit, allocate, compare, copie, delete, and print files of any standard mvs access method. To release control of data sets allocated either with allocate or in the startup jcl, use the free command.
Ibm utilities iebgener iebcopy iebcompr iehlist iebr14. Copies pds on to tapes by converting it to sequential dataset. This tutorial will show you how to merge two files or two sets of records using ibm dfsort. Coding jcl statements identifier field the identifier field indicates to the system that a statement is a jcl statement rather than data. Politics fileaid utility in jcl pdf admin july 22, 2019 no comments. Allocating and directing files dynamically m204wiki. Instantiate the merge utility class as shown below. Fileaid table of contents sysedcomputer education techniques, inc. Jcl consists of control statements that introduces a computer job to an os.
Exclude members of pds within copy the syntax of the copy control statement. Understand the changes made to improve jcl processing new statements designed to reduce reliance on jecl. The jcl needed for a merge is the same as that for a sort, with the following exceptions. Instead of the sortin dd statement, you use sortinnn dd statements to define the input data sets.
Searchupdate utility scanning and updating datasets1. Item an item in upper case is a literal value, to be specified as shown. Every day thousands of users submit information to us about which programs they use to open specific types of files. Every mainframe professional feels a little bit hard when working with sort. Icetool is a multipurpose dfsort utility that uses the capabilities of dfsort to perform multiple operations on one or more data sets in a single step. The mnemonic used in the ibm assembler was br and hence the name. Dfsort is ibms highperformance sort, merge, copy, and.
Jjccll uuttiilliittyy pprrooggrraammss ibm dataset utilities utility programs are prewritten programs, widely used in mainframes by system programmers and application developers to achieve daytoday requirements, organising and maintaining data. The daytoday application requirements in a corporate world that can be achieved using utility programs are illustrated below. Select multiple pdf files and merge them in seconds. Job conversion the jcl along with the proc is converted into an interpreted text to be understood by jes and stored into a dataset, which we call as spool. To merge pdfs or just to add a page to a pdf you usually have to buy expensive software. This utility was written late at night at a customer site to help me determine the difference between ini settings on a machine that was configured correctly and a machine that was not executing an application correctly. The jcl expander tool in smart ts xl displays all included procs, parms, dsns and other symbolic variables as they would appear in the jcl at runtime. It is a means of communication between a program that can be written in cobol, assember or pli and the mvs operating system. The actual device names or numbers depend on how your. File aid is having two types one which is used for file operations and second one is used for db2 file aid for db2. The 1st fileaid step could read in the b file and create control cards for the 2nd fileaid step. Fileaid fileaid is a versatile utility that is basically used for reformatting data while copying from another data set.
C provides online access to files unavailable to the ispf pdf user. Job control language jcl is a name for scripting languages used on ibm mainframe operating systems to instruct the system on how to run a batch job or start a subsystem. By using combo pdf tool, you can also extract or remove pages from document, protect pdf security, encrypt, decrypt, secure, watermark, bookmark pdf and create new file. Combine pdfs in the order you want with the easiest pdf merger available. File aid is a versatile utility that is basically used for reformatting data while copying from another data set. Free web app to quickly and easily combine multiple files into one pdf online. A merge statement can also be used to specify a copy application. Fileaid for db2 table of contents sysedcomputer education techniques, inc. Both files matching records inner join write only records that match on key from both files. Normally inserted to jcl when the only desired action is allocation or deletion of datasets or jcl syntax checking for errors.
Job control language 6 job submission submitting the jcl to jes. Jcl identifies the program to be executed, the inputs that are required. If you have a requirement to check empty file before applying certain operations then it can be done using icetool or fileaid or idcams utilities. For a partitioned database pds, you can browse, edit, and copy an individual member or the entire dataset. Apart from several usage of this utility like copy data sets, concatenate datasets etc. Sortmerge users guide vi 47 a2 08uf syntax notation the following conventions are used for presenting jcl command syntax. The first 10 records need to be written to output file. No other product provides as much power and flexibility as fileaid mvs to create test data specific to individual needs and securely resolve production problems. Jun 05, 2008 the adobe acrobat user community is a global resource for users of acrobat and pdf, with free eseminars, tips, tutorials, videos and discussion forums. Can we merge two files using fileaid this can be done with fileaid, however, it would take two fileaid steps to accomplish. These programs are controlled by jcl statements and utility control statements. Both storage management subsystem sms and nonsms jcl are discussed. It is a program you use to sort, merge, and copy the data from one file to another file. By voting up you can indicate which examples are most useful and appropriate.
Generate the jcl required to submit a file aid batch job or any other non file aid batch utility with file aid s batch submit. Dfsort a simple example for merging, we need two sets of data. A formatted mode that allows you to browse and edit. Sort join to join two files based on a key we can make use of sort to join two files and writes records from both files 1. Below is the general structure of fileaid batch processing jcl. The jcl needed for a merge is the same as that for a. While we do not yet have a description of the jcl file format and what it is normally used for, we do know which programs are known to open these files. Most of the installations change the syncsort utility program name to sort.
This suite includes examples for iebgener, idcams and repro, sort, dfsort, icetool and iceman with sort, merge, copy and concatenate functions running on zos mainframe or micro focus enterprise server. I need to get the output as start position and length of the copybook member from a pds using fileaid utility in batch. You can invoke these utilities in a jcl jobstream, tso clist or rexx exec by using the same program names, data sets and commands as on the mainframe. May 29, 2012 as we all know, in jcl knowing sort with dfsort utility is a niche area. Free pdf merge free download fileplanet free pdf merge. It is a means of communication between a program written in cobol, assembler or pl1 and mvs operating system. Fileaid is the backbone to compuwares test data optimization solution, enabling developers to rightsize their test data, select the right data to exercise test conditions and secure it to guard against breaches. Sort fields starting position, length, format, ascdes, starting position, length, format, ascdes. You must specify dynamic allocation units in the jcl for the run. Fileaid makes it easy to browseedit by providing the. You do not need dynamic allocation of work data sets or sortwkdd dd statements instead of the sortin dd statement, you use sortinnn dd statements to define the input data sets. Our pdf merger allows you to quickly combine multiple pdf files into one single pdf document, in just a few clicks. Split pdf files into individual pages, delete or rotate pages, easily merge pdf files together or edit and modify pdf files. The idcams also known as access method services is a versatile utility that can be invoked in batch mode with jcl or interactively with tso commands.
1032 176 720 1502 243 728 231 1023 777 1328 942 1294 145 630 87 1069 103 530 1439 1111 1209 979 1159 38 1336 956 700 714 794 593 290 1523 1307 159 1292 1276 1364 726 1460 1126 1461